Output e52b3ece8cf62043e7c351dd19ed1707eae4b97fbc1806e6de1ffed875761960:0

value
76727490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88b14b0873428653a59c8db7025465bb9327de1a OP_EQUAL
address
3E9nDAzV3Qv76hHxBnPtPWfYDZbxYLRVXG
transaction
e52b3ece8cf62043e7c351dd19ed1707eae4b97fbc1806e6de1ffed875761960
confirmations
292320
spent
true